Koelreuteria Paniculata (Golden Rain Tree) PB18
An elegant, slow-growing small tree with serrated, green, pinnate leaves and branches which droop at the ends creating a slight weeping effect. The foliage turns bronze to gold in autumn and is held on the tree until quite late in the season. In summer, chains of bright yellow flowers are produced, followed by papery lantern-like seed pods which hang from the tree in large clusters. Prefers full sun and can tolerate poor soil conditions including clay. Deciduous.
Mature height: 10m x 10m
